| Nan Goldin photography books. Recognized
internationally for her intimate and compelling images, the American
photographer Nan Goldin (b.1953) has lived and worked in Boston, New York,
Berlin and in Paris, her current home. Since the early 1970s Goldin has
taken numerous photographs of her friends and 'family', which form a
significant and important body of work.She is most famous for her Ballad of
Sexual Dependency photographs, a constantly changing slide show of
approximately 750 photographs set to music. Goldin's life and friends became
the focus of her work - a diary of friends and lovers in Europe and America,
in the underground and gay scene. Her work often breaks social taboos with its explicit
exploration of relationships, sexualtiy and eroticism. More recently, her
images have shown the devastating effect AIDS has had of this community of
